Transaction 0670760c596be0aaf5b9f39e85bd41123c2096fda95b3a85a6b84da1676a27a3

1 Input
2 Outputs
  • 0670760c596be0aaf5b9f39e85bd41123c2096fda95b3a85a6b84da1676a27a3:0
  • value  391161
    address  1P47CmUZanYqeKD143eaLywTScjTpiGtdR
  • 0670760c596be0aaf5b9f39e85bd41123c2096fda95b3a85a6b84da1676a27a3:1
  • value  414080
    address  358KS44YPYx4ZTZHJb2QZPEioeKebSDShx